Roll20: Roll20 is a popular virtual tabletop platform for playing tabletop roleplaying games online. It provides digital character sheets, dice rolling, maps, tokens, and tools to run RPGs virtually with friends across the internet.

TuDee: TuDee is a free and open-source task management application. It allows users to create tasks, set due dates, add checklists, organize tasks into projects and tag them. TuDee has apps for Web, Windows, Mac, Linux, iOS and Android.

Pros & Cons Analysis

Roll20
Roll20
Pros
  • Easy to use interface
  • Works on any device with a browser
  • Large library of free assets
  • Active community support
  • Allows playing tabletop RPGs remotely
Cons
  • Can be laggy with large maps/lots of tokens
  • Voice chat quality not as good as Discord
  • Subscription required for some features
  • Set-up can be time consuming
TuDee
TuDee
Pros
  • Free and open source
  • Available on many platforms
  • Good for basic task management
Cons
  • Limited features compared to paid options
  • No team collaboration features
  • Can be slow and buggy
